Working Principles

MP26056DQ-LF-P operates as a synchronous buck converter, converting the input voltage to a lower, regulated output voltage. It utilizes pulse width modulation (PWM) techniques to control the switching of the internal power MOSFETs, achieving high efficiency and accurate voltage regulation.
